What Is an IP Address?

IP stands for Internet Protocol and is a unique identifier that your device has on the internet. It’s like a phone number, except instead of being assigned by a company, it’s assigned by your internet service provider (ISP).

Your IP address is used to help route information around the internet. Every device that connects to the internet needs an IP address so that other devices know where to send data.

Your IP address also allows websites to track your location, but you can use a VPN to hide your real IP address and prevent this tracking.

There are two types of IP addresses: IPv4 and IPv6. IPv4 is the older version of IP addresses, and most ISPs are still using IPv4 today. However, IPv6 is the newer version, which allows for many more unique IP addresses. Because IPv6 uses 128-bit numbers instead of 32-bit numbers like IPv4 does, it can support many more devices and users.

What’s the Difference Between Public and Private IP Addresses?

The short answer is that public IP addresses are assigned to devices connected to the internet, while private IP addresses are assigned to devices on a private network, such as your home network.

A public IP address is used to access the internet from any device, while a private IP address is only valid on your local network. So, if you’re using a public IP address to access the internet, your traffic goes through a router. This means that any device on the internet can see your traffic and know who you are.

What’s the Difference Between Static and Dynamic IP Addresses?

The difference between these two types of IP addresses is that a static IP address is the same every time you connect to the internet. A dynamic IP address is one that changes every time you connect.

With a static IP, it is easier for people to monitor your online activity because they can follow what you are doing by looking up just one address. Since dynamic IP addresses change with each online session, it is more difficult for hackers and other people to track your online activity because they will have to look up multiple addresses.

If you want to stay safe and anonymous when you connect to the internet, a dynamic IP address is the way to go. However, if you are a small business owner and you have an online storefront, it is important that you have a static IP address. This will allow customers to find your website easily and make purchases without any issues.

How Do I Hide My IP Address?

If you want to hide your IP address, change it to a different one. There are two ways to do this:

The first way is to use a proxy server. A proxy server is a computer that acts as an intermediary between your device and the website you want to visit. This means that the website will see the proxy server’s IP address, not yours.

The second way to hide your IP address is to use a VPN. A VPN, or virtual private network, is a service that will give you a new IP address and hide your real location. VPNs are more secure than proxies because they encrypt your data and provide better privacy. However, they are also more expensive and slower than proxies.

Internet Blocked? How to Access Blocked Sites While Traveling?

How to Access Blocked Sites While Traveling

Traveling can be a great way to get away from it all, but sometimes it’s not so great when you can’t access your favorite websites while you’re away from home.

Whether you’re traveling abroad or just going on a business trip, there are plenty of times when you might want to access a website that isn’t available in your current location.

If you’re traveling outside the United States, you may find that some websites are blocked by your internet service provider (ISP), your hotel, or the country you’re visiting. For example, if you try to access websites like Facebook, YouTube, Google, Instagram, Netflix, and Spotify while traveling in China, you may find that you can’t access them.

The same goes for many websites in Iran, Saudi Arabia, Vietnam, Cuba, and other countries where internet censorship is common. However, there are ways to bypass this type of censorship and access blocked sites from anywhere in the world.

1) Use a VPN

A virtual private network (VPN) is one of the best ways to access blocked websites. A VPN creates a secure connection between your device and the internet, allowing you to change your IP address and appear as if you were in a different country. This is particularly useful for accessing geo-locked streaming sites such as Netflix, Hulu, HBO, BBC iPlayer, and Amazon Prime Video.

You can purchase a VPN subscription from a number of different providers, but keep in mind that not all VPNs are created equally. It’s important to do some research before you purchase a VPN to make sure it offers the type of service you need.

2) Use a Proxy

A proxy server is another way to access blocked websites. It works in a similar fashion as a VPN, but instead of creating a secure connection between your device and the internet, it routes all traffic through an intermediary server.

While this can be a good way to access blocked websites, it’s important to note that proxies don’t encrypt your data or protect you from hackers. If you have sensitive information on your device and want to keep it private, using a VPN is a better option than using a proxy server.
